Output ecfdc05d34c749f71e3a710d2fc5e402e19ab184efa7846f3bb824578e620560:3

value
25316712
script pubkey
OP_0 OP_PUSHBYTES_20 eabf0b546c2c762c1dbea659e7521fa7c624510a
address
bc1qa2lsk4rv93mzc8d75ev7w5sl5lrzg5g2y0dav3
transaction
ecfdc05d34c749f71e3a710d2fc5e402e19ab184efa7846f3bb824578e620560
spent
true